Cloudflare One and CloudCodes For Business compete in the network security and management category. Cloudflare One has the upper hand in global network performance and advanced security protocols, while CloudCodes For Business leads in identity and access management capabilities.
Features: Cloudflare One's key features include DDoS protection, secure web gateway, and network performance optimization. CloudCodes For Business focuses on single sign-on, identity management, and enhanced access control.
Ease of Deployment and Customer Service: Cloudflare One offers a straightforward deployment with extensive online resources and a scalable architecture. CloudCodes For Business requires a more involved setup due to its customizable options but benefits from dedicated support channels.
Pricing and ROI: Cloudflare One generally has a higher initial investment due to its vast network resources and security tools, promising long-term ROI through network efficiency gains. CloudCodes For Business provides a competitive initial pricing model with ROI through effective management of user access and reduced administrative overhead.

CloudCodes for Business is a cloud security platform that offers various solutions to protect organizations' data and applications in the cloud. It focuses on providing security and management capabilities for cloud services, enabling organizations to enforce policies, secure data, and control user access within their cloud environments.
CloudCodes for Business Features:
CloudCodes for Business may function as a CASB, offering security controls and visibility for cloud applications and services. It helps organizations secure and monitor user activities within popular cloud platforms such as G Suite, Office 365, Salesforce, and more.
The platform may provide data loss prevention capabilities, allowing organizations to define and enforce policies to prevent the unauthorized disclosure or leakage of sensitive data. It helps protect against data breaches and ensures compliance with data privacy regulations.
CloudCodes for Business helps organizations enforce granular access controls for cloud applications. It may offer features such as single sign-on (SSO), multi-factor authentication (MFA), and identity and access management (IAM) functionalities to ensure secure and authenticated access to cloud services.
The platform may include user behavior monitoring capabilities to detect and analyze abnormal or risky user activities within cloud applications. It helps identify potential insider threats, account compromises, or unauthorized access attempts.
CloudCodes for Business may conduct security assessments of cloud services and applications, providing insights into their security posture and potential vulnerabilities. It helps organizations make informed decisions about the adoption of specific cloud services and assess their overall risk exposure.
The platform may assist organizations in meeting regulatory compliance requirements by providing policy enforcement, auditing capabilities, and reporting functionalities. It helps organizations demonstrate adherence to data privacy and security regulations.
Cloudflare One is a single-vendor Secure Access Service Edge (SASE) platform that enables Zero Trust security and any-to-any connectivity across enterprise applications, users, devices, and networks. Cloudflare One helps organizations simplify, modernize, and consolidate their IT architecture by converging security and networking services on our single global network and control plane.
Many organizations start by adopting our Security Service Edge (SSE) services — like ZTNA, SWG, CASB, and DLP — to reduce their attack surface, stop threats like phishing and ransomware, protect data, and apply identity-based Zero Trust verification across web, SaaS, and private app environments. Others prioritize simplifying network connectivity across offices, data centers, and cloud environments with our WANaaS.
Every service is available for customers to run in every location across Cloudflare’s global network, which today spans 330+ cities in 120+ countries, so you can scale connectivity with fast, consistent protections everywhere.
